What is Key Programming?
Key programming refers to the procedure of coding or programming a vehicle key or key fob to interact successfully with the vehicle's onboard computer system. Each key or fob is uniquely programmed to match the vehicle's requirements, making sure that only licensed keys can start the engine or access the vehicle's other functions.
Cars today typically use various kinds of keys:
- Traditional Metal Keys: Basic keys without electronic parts.
- Transponder Keys: Features a chip that interacts with the car's immobilizer.
- Key Fobs: Often utilized for remote locking/unlocking, may include extra functions like panic buttons or remote start.
- Smart Keys: Advanced keyless entry systems that enable for push-button start capabilities.

Where to Find Key Programming Services Near You?
When trying to find key programming services nearby, there are a number of alternatives to think about:
1. Dealers
- Pros:
- Specialized in the makes and designs they sell.
- Access to O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turer) parts.
- Cons:
- Often more pricey than other alternatives.
- Longer wait times for visits.
2. Automotive Locksmiths
- Pros:
- Usually lower prices compared to dealerships.
- Mobile services offered, providing convenience.
- Cons:
- Experience might differ by locksmith professional, demanding due diligence ahead of time.
3. Independent Auto Repair Shops
- Pros:
- Can provide competitive pricing and customized service.
- Might have skilled specialists knowledgeable in key programming.
- Cons:
- Not all stores will supply key programming services.
4. Huge Box Retailers
- Pros:
- Some provide key duplication and programming services.
- May have kiosks for more uncomplicated keys.
- Cons:
- Limited to standard key types; not all services are gotten approved for advanced vehicles.

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)
What does it cost to have a key programmed?
The cost can vary commonly based on the kind of key and the provider. Standard key programming can range from ₤ 50 to ₤ 150, while more complicated wise keys can cost upwards of ₤ 300, specifically through car dealerships.
How long does key programming take?
Programming a key normally takes anywhere from 15 minutes to an hour, depending upon the type of key and the company. Dealers may take longer due to procedural steps.
Can I program my key myself?
Some car designs do allow owners to program their keys utilizing a particular sequence. Nevertheless, these methods differ considerably throughout designs and may need tools and time. Always consult your car handbook.
What should I do if I have lost all my keys?
If all keys are lost, it is vital to call a locksmith professional or dealer as quickly as possible. They will frequently require the Vehicle Identification Number (VIN) and proof of ownership to program a new key.
Is key programming the same for all cars?
No, key programming differs extensively depending on the make and model of the vehicle. Some manufacturers have particular procedures, and not all locksmith professionals might have the equipment to manage every vehicle brand name.
